#f9d500 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f9d500 is composed of 97.6% red, 83.5%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.5% magenta, 100%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 51.3 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 48.8%. #f9d500 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#f3ab00.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c00.

#f9d500 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#f9d500 has RGB values of R:249, G:213,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.14, Y:1,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 16372992.

Shades and Tints of #f9d500

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0c00 is the darkest color, while #fffef9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f9d500

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#868373 is the less saturated color, while #f9d500 is the most saturated one.
